Characterization of nucleotidic sequences using maximum entropy techniques

J Theor Biol. 1990 Dec 7;147(3):423-32. doi: 10.1016/s0022-5193(05)80497-7.

Abstract

A statistical method for characterizing nucleotidic sequences based on maximum entropy techniques is presented. The method uses only codon usage tables and takes into account the length of sequences, and preserves the information contained in each codon by a punctual index. We present the methodological aspects of the analysis, showing an application relative to nucleotidic sequences of eukaryotes.
